The Romans produced a sewer system to move waste and excrement away from their old capital city now referred to as Rome, Italy. This elaborate drain system started as an open air canal constructed by the Etruscans. The Romans progressively developed over the open air canal and transformed the Cloaca Maxima right into a protected sewer system.

Some components of the Cloaca Maxima are still being used to this extremely day. If you have actually not listened to of Thomas Crapper, he was a successful plumbing technician and sanitation engineer.

Crapper has been falsely credited with the invention many thanks to his work on toilets, however his contributions to shower room history were still considerable: As a matter of fact, he opened up the world's very first restroom display room in 1870. The annual water lost in the USA as a result of water leakages in our homes is ONE TRILLION gallons of water threw away yearly.

According to WaterSense, the ordinary household's leakages can account for virtually 10,000 gallons of water squandered annually, and 10 percent of homes have leakages that waste 90 gallons or more daily.
